修水论坛-修水网旗下论坛

 找回密码
 注册
查看: 731|回复: 0
打印 上一主题 下一主题

..如何设置Discuz!x2.5管理员登录超时时间

[复制链接]
跳转到指定楼层
1#
wolong 发表于 2014-3-13 20:43:58 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
你应该留意了,当你登录Discuz!X2.5管理后台后,如长时间无操作,系统会自动退出管理员,需要您重新登录一次。还有一种登陆Discuz!X2.5后台管理系统会记录管理员登录IP地址,如果管理员登录IP地址临时变化了,系统也会提示重新登陆。

一、要解决的问题

1、管理员的IP发生变化,系统会要求重新登录。

2、后台长时间不操作,系统会在1800秒之后自动退出管理员,提示要求重新登陆。

二、解决的方法

解决这个两个问题不难,你只需要下php代码的几个参数就可以了。

解决用户困扰1:管理员的IP发生变化,系统会要求重新登录。

登录php虚拟主机ftp,下载“/config/config_global.php”文件,在本地用文本编辑器打开,大约在第86行位置,请你把:

view sourceprint?
1 $_config['admincp']['checkip'] = 1;
替换为:

view sourceprint?
1 $_config['admincp']['checkip'] = 0;
解决用户困扰2:后台长时间不操作,系统默认超时时间1800秒之后自动退出管理员,提示要求重新登陆。

登录php虚拟主机ftp,下载“/source/class/discus/discuz_admincp.php”文件,在本地用文本编辑器打开,大约在第32行位置,请你把:

view sourceprint?
1 var $sessionlife = 1800;
替换为:

view sourceprint?
1 var $sessionlife = 1800000;
参数“1800”就是系统默认超时时间,请你根据自己的实际需要修改。

修改完毕,将两个文件上传到空间覆盖后,登录dz管理员后台更新网站缓存,问题解决。

您需要登录后才可以回帖 登录 | 注册

本版积分规则

关闭

站长推荐上一条 /1 下一条

QQ|Archiver|手机版|小黑屋|修水网 ( 赣ICP备05004636号 )- 备案报警修水网1000人超级群

GMT+8, 2024-4-26 11:55 , Processed in 0.101006 second(s), 24 queries .

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表